Droid 4: Got HDMI cable/adapter -- doesn't work

I don't really need the HDMI output (have Netflix and YouTube on my DVR), but thought it would be nice to have. So I bought the Fosmon HDMI to Micro HDMI cable (6 ft) for $2.95 from Amazon.com for my Droid 4.

When I first plugged it in, the Motorola logo started bouncing around on the screen, as if it were in screen saving mode. And that's all that happened. I tried YouTube and Netflix, and both gave me blank screens. Got video and audio on my Droid 4, but nothing on the TV except the Motorola logo. Thinking that I may have to have WiFi turned on (I usually leave it off), I turned it on, got a decent signal from my wireless router, and still nothing on the TV screen except the Motorola logo. The only HDMI setting in the Settings area was for over scan: it was set in the middle, so I left it there.

So, where did I go wrong? :angry:
